Description: The American Lung Association in California is committed to fighting for the right to breathe clean and healthy air. This is accomplished by working with state and local leaders on issues that impact lung health – from creating smoke-free environments, enhancing tobacco prevention and control programs, reducing air pollution and global warming, and improving health care. The American Lung Association in California fights to eliminate the impact of tobacco and make California smokefree through key advocacy roles on propositions, assembly bills and Senate bills as well as work on State of Tobacco Control Reports, State of the Air reports, and the California Cancer Research Act, among others.
